When Yamaha designed the 450 Series clarinets, they conceived it as an instrument that a player just starting out, would want to continue playing well into the future. Part of that concept revolved not only in performance characteristics, but also addressing the durability issues inherent with student musicians using a wood clarinet. To address this concept to its fullest potential, Yamaha released the Duet Clarinet concept.
Duet Clarinet Bore
The Yamaha 450 Duet+ Clarinet utilizes the same bore and key design of the intermediate Yamaha 450 clarinets. With the Duet+ model, the upper joint has the wood intentionally over-cut with both it’s bore and tonehole diameters. This upper joint is then injected using a Thermoplastic ABS resin so that the entire bore of the upper joint (clarinet & toneholes) are one solid piece of ABS plastic. However, since the exterior of the joint is Grenadilla wood, the player receives both the performance of a wood clarinet but with the enhanced durability from the plastic bore. Professional Setup
Every instrument we send out to a customer is not released from us unless it has been completely setup in our shop first. This is because the setup on a musical instrument is of the utmost importance! Sometimes, a clarinet (regardless of who the manufacturer) comes in needing 20 minutes of adjustments and then the very next one can require 2 hours! So if you were to get 5 of the same model right out of the box, they will all play different. This leads players to believe that they are “good” or “bad” clarinets. The reality is that the one that was the best out of the 5 was likely the one that needed the least amount of work and the “bad” clarinet was the one that needed 2 hours worth of adjustments!
Once the same 5 clarinets are properly regulated and adjusted to perfection, they become near identical instruments. Even the pickiest of players would be challenged to pick a true “favorite”. However, since most stores do not or even can not perform this setup, the player never knows this and is simply relying on the luck of the draw. Yamaha 450 2nd Gen Duet Clarinet Specifications
| Model | YCL-450IINM |
| Body Material | Grenadilla – Upper Joint with Molded Plastic Bore |
| Tone Holes | Undercut |
| Barrel | 65mm, based on professional series design |
| Bell Feature | Redesigned bell for a richer, broader tone in the lower register |
| Pads | White Leather |
| Mouthpiece | Yamaha 4C |
| Case | Standard Case |
